James Bond 007: Blood Stone is a 2010 third-person shooter and action-adventure game that has become a sought-after title for PC gamers, particularly due to its removal from major digital storefronts like Steam. Developed by Bizarre Creations and published by Activision, it features an original story set between the films Quantum of Solace and Skyfall, voiced by Daniel Craig and Judi Dench. Availability and Digital Status

As of 2026, James Bond 007: Blood Stone is considered abandonware because it is no longer available for purchase on digital platforms like Steam or the Xbox Marketplace, largely due to expired licensing agreements between Activision and the Bond franchise.

is a 2010 third-person action-adventure shooter featuring the voice and likeness of Daniel Craig. The game was developed by Bizarre Creations and published by Activision

, though it has since been delisted from digital stores like Steam due to expired licensing. Core Gameplay & Features Combat Mix

: The game blends third-person gunplay with a cinematic hand-to-hand combat system.

: A unique mechanic that rewards melee takedowns with "Focus" points, allowing players to execute instant, accurate shots. Driving Sequences

: As a Bond title, it includes high-speed vehicle missions, such as boat chases and driving an Aston Martin DBS V12 The Lost Mission: Why Gamers Are Still Hunting

: Bond is tasked with stopping a bio-terrorist threat involving a stolen British biochemical project, traveling to locations like Athens, Istanbul, Bangkok, and Monaco Repack Details (FitGirl/DODI)

In the vast digital library of video games, some titles fade into obscurity, while others achieve a strange, enduring immortality through the piracy and preservation communities. James Bond 007: Blood Stone is one of the latter.

Released in 2010 by Activision and developed by Bizarre Creations (the studio behind the beloved Project Gotham Racing), Blood Stone was a curious hybrid: part third-person shooter, part racing game, and fully endorsed by the Bond film franchise. But if you search for the game today, you won’t find it on Steam or the PlayStation Store. Due to licensing expiring in 2012, the game was delisted, making it commercially extinct.
